Output 00fdbefba43b13112d34218368a8e2688f2d8d393c7a74cf38f73c16d4ef7413:1

value
27336814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d40d3b2b242b955db6c15a8a9eadcb1aee162295 OP_EQUAL
address
3M2F2XVpfLzL613VqiwhFqgvm2oLrgEqHs
transaction
00fdbefba43b13112d34218368a8e2688f2d8d393c7a74cf38f73c16d4ef7413
confirmations
349028
spent
true